The Journey to the West was a long novel written by Wu Chengen, a novelist of the Ming Dynasty. It told the story of Sun Wukong and others who went to the West to obtain scriptures. The plot of this novel was full of ups and downs, and the characters were vivid. It was regarded as a classic work of China classical novels. When I read the second part of Journey to the West, I deeply felt Wu Chengen's deep understanding and exquisite expression of China traditional culture. In the novel, Sun Wukong and the others finally succeeded in obtaining the true scripture after going through countless hardships. In this process, they encountered all kinds of challenges and difficulties, but they always maintained an optimistic spirit and courage. Through the description of these characters, the novel promoted the optimistic and indomitable spirit of China traditional culture, making people feel the strength and courage of life. In addition, the Buddhist elements in the novel were also very rich. Sun Wukong and the others gradually understood the true meaning of Buddhism under the influence of Buddhist thoughts and moral education. This Buddhist element not only enriched the theme of the novel, but also made people deeply feel the integration of China traditional culture and Buddhist culture. Journey to the West is an excellent novel, which not only has the unique charm of China traditional culture, but also combines the thoughts of Buddhist culture, deeply expressing the power of human nature and life. The book, Alive, showed the various faces of human nature and made the readers deeply feel the strength and fragility of human nature. The protagonist in the story, Fu Gui, showed patience, selflessness, and deep love for his family. His experience made people think that love and kindness still existed in a cruel world. The story was told in plain and simple language. There was not much emotion, but there was a certain sense of involvement. Fu Gui's squandering, family breakdown, and his miserable life made people feel heartbroken, but at the same time, it made people think about the meaning and value of life. Through Fu Gui's story, the book Alive showed the readers the hardships and setbacks of life. It taught us how to face difficulties, cherish life and the people around us, and how to live our own value and meaning. After reading this book, people felt the reality of life and the complexity of human nature.
